Six stringer #5...build #59. This one has a hand made figured maple neck w/ truss rod. Rosewood fingerboard, 21 frets, walnut in the headstock, rosewood truss rod cover plate & tailpiece. Adjustable/floating walnut bridge. Mini humbucker w/ volume & tone controls. Corona cigar box with hand painted top depicting a Scottish Thistle...banner reads "Nemo me impune lacessit"...roughly translates to "No one may harm me without penalty".

This one is a 13" box and a 7" cone.
The strat neck has a predetermined scale and the cone centre needs to be 4.5" from the tail. This means your neck will have very little overhang with the box so you will be needing a through box support to screw the neck to. Regarding bracing for mine I opted for a 2 layer body (as I haven't access to a router with 2 layers I can make a neck pocket with my scroll saw)
I also use hinges x2 at the top and hinges x2 plus tailpiece at the bottom to help brace the top/bottom sides of the box.
Good luck with the build - the Lowe cones are brilliant to work with.
